RAID的小插曲·二

上次提到我在一台跑应用的机器上使用mdadm做了个RAID-0,实际使用中发现了一些效能方面的下降。
具体来说就是svctm和%util数值上升。
我当时推测可能是Chunk设置太小导致的,所以我在前两天分别调整了Chunk大小,做了新的测试。

# cat /proc/mdstat
Personalities : [raid0]
md0 : active raid0 sda1[0] sdb1[1]
      468860064 blocks super 1.2 16k chunks

# cat /proc/mdstat
Personalities : [raid0]
md0 : active raid0 sda1[0] sdb1[1]
      468860032 blocks super 1.2 32k chunks

在Chunk被设置为16k与32k的情况下,分别跑了一天应用,结果发现在小文件io的时候%util数值上升非常严重。
老实说我拿不准到底是哪方面出的问题,等下一周有时间我试试直接把Chunk大小提升到128k。

发表评论

电子邮件地址不会被公开。 必填项已用*标注